Identification of virulence markers in VHS
The PhD scholar will contribute to the project “Identification of virulence markers in marine VHS virus and use in diagnostics for aquaculture” funded by The Danish Research Council for Technology and Production Sciences (FTP).

Production of rainbow trout in marine aquaculture is an expanding industry in Denmark, but a circulating reservoir of the fish pathogenic viral haemorrhagic septicaemia virus (VHSV) in wild fish populations represents an important threat towards the future success of these activities.

The primary task of the PhD scholar will be to determine the genetic background for virulence of VHSV isolates to rainbow trout. Various molecular tools will be applied such as reverse genetics for generation of recombinant virus, in vivo imaging and immunofluorescense for in situ pathogenesis studies as well as virulence testing in small scale animal experiments. The expected result will be improved understanding of pathogen virulence and identification of genetic markers for virulence of VHSV isolates in rainbow trout. The obtained results will be used for development of a diagnostic tool for rapid virulence-typing of VHSV isolates.
